> Thanks for the information on the base plate dimensions. I like the
>way Bill incorporated the eyepiece/accessory holder into his plate.
>Michael's wedge design is very nice. One thing I noticed was there are
>different dimensions for the three holes for the telescope mount. I
>assume that Michael's dimensions , at 6 1/2 ~ 6 3/4" is correct for the
>12" base. Bill's dimensions are 4 1/4". Is this for an 8" or 10" scope?
>Or is it different because of a production change? Any ideas?

I think I measured wrong. The picture clearly shows that distance
being about 6.5 not 4.5. Since my LX200 is currently sitting on top
of that plate I didn't measure it directly. Instead I measured the
holes on the top of my (unused :-) tripod. I guess they're
different. Trust Michael's numbers.

But, yes, mine is a 12". I believe the base is the same for all
LX200's except the 16".
